Title of article :
A novel grey target decision-making model based on cobweb area and its application for choosing the software development pattern

Abstract :
A grey target decision-making model is an eective method used to look for a
relatively optimal decision-making scheme. In this method, whether a scheme is good or bad
is determined through comparing the square sums of the dierences between the evaluated
indices and the optimal indices. However, such \power operation" probably results in
amplication or reduction of some extreme index values in decision-making results. In
this paper, an improved method, based on cobweb area, is proposed. Here, an index is
represented by a line drawn from the bullʹs-eye, with equal angles between adjacent lines.
Then, data points are determined on the lines so that the length of a line segment represents
the size of the index value. Each point is then connected in order, and a cobweb-like
geometrical gure is obtained. With the proposed gure, each scheme could be evaluated
by nding the area of its corresponding cobweb. The proposed model was applied in
choosing the preferred software development mode of the Chana Group Oce Automation
system, and its performance was then compared with that of the traditional grey target
decision-making model. The comparison shows that the new model is superior to the
traditional grey target model
